my buddy got one when he heard i was saving up for an academy sbv2 pro and ill tell ya what that car is tough, it takes the abuse with pride, the stock motor sucks though, it goes like 12 mph and after about 2 days he ordered the yeah racing 13.5 turn bl system. it hauls now!

the only suggestion id make is get new tires/rims (the stock ones suuuck), lotsa spare spurs and ball links, ball screws and heads cuz he seems to break them alot

he runs HB 1/10th buggy rims made for the d4 cyclone, he got them on A-Main hobbies, the tire choice youll have to make yourself depending on what surfaces you run on (duh).

but you can run any 4wd specific 1/10th buggy tires on the market, also, if the rims you want dont use hexs your ok cuz all you have to do is remove the hex from the axle. (we found this out when i was helping him find a set, it seems like common sense but most ppl dont realise it)

lol those motors and rims are POS!

edit: HB - hot bodies racing (hpi's racing brand)

not sure about the vortex, but my buddys running the 13.5 t bl yeah racing motor (it was $75 for whole system) , its not super quick but its a crap load more user friendly than my vxl. and its got enough power to make quick laps around the local track. they also make a 9 turn version, all are brushless.

the reason i suggest it so highly is cuz its so user friendly, and has alot of very good features, in my opinion, for the price you pay new, you get a system thats worth much much more. i cant say enough about it. the only drawback is that its sensorless so you cant run a race if they are roar affiliated and enforce roar's rules.
